Brand new softcover book! Never been read! ; This book was originally published in 1853 in England by Elder Orson Pratt. In the Preface to the original edition he wrote:

"The following pages, embracing biographical sketches and the genealogy of Joseph Smith, the Prophet, and his progenitors, were mostly written previous to the death of the Prophet, and under his personal inspection.

"Most of the historical items have never been published. They will therefore be exceedingly interesting to all Saints and sincere inquirers after the truth, affording them the privilege of becoming more extensively acquainted with the private life and character of one of the greatest prophets that ever lived on the earth. Independent of this, the events which occurred in connection with the history of this remarkable family, are, in themselves, of the most marvelous kind, and of infinite importance in their bearings upon the present and future generations."

Although Elder Pratt was apparently happy with his publication, Brigham Young and others in Utah were not. The book was subsequently destroyed and suppressed. After revision, it was again made available to the Saints in 1901. In the Preface to the revised edition President Joseph F. Smith wrote:

"In September, 1852, Apostle Orson Pratt went on a mission to England . . . And being shown the manuscript copy, he purchased it for a certain sum of money, took it to Liverpool with him, where, without revision and without the consent or knowledge of President Young or any of the Twelve, it was published under his direction in 1853. It was afterwards discovered that the book contained errors, occasioned by its not being carefully compared with historical data. Some of the statements written in the Preface by Elder Pratt were also in error; one especially that the book was mostly written in the lifetime of the Prophet, and that he had read it with approval, was incorrect, since it was written in 1845, the year following his martyrdom. For these reasons and others, mostly of a financial character, it was disapproved by President Young on August 23, 1865, and the edition was suppressed or destroyed."

Because of its historical significance, the edition presented here is the Liverpool, 1853 Edition. ; 5" x 8"; 279 pages,
